Plum and Walnut Baked Brie

Delicious baked brie for appetizer with crackers

Ingredients

2 tablespoons Plum preserves

2 teaspoons Water

1 Wheel ripe brie, well-chilled and rind left on (15 ounce)

1 Firm red plum, thinly sliced

1 to 2 tablespoons Chopped walnuts

Preparation

Preheat oven to 350 degrees.

Melt preserves and water in a small pan over low heat.

Brush melted preserves over the top and sides of well-chilled brie.

Arrange plum slices decoratively on top of the brie.

Brush fruit with additional melted preserves.

Sprinkle with walnuts.

Place brie on foil lined baking sheet with low sides.

Bake 10 - 15 minutes in center of oven until heated through.

Remove and let stand 2-3 minutes.


With large spatula carefully transfer to serving platter.


Serve with lahvosh crackers, torn pieces of Tuscan bread and pear slices.

Recipe Details

Total Preparation Time: Less than 15 minutes
Actual Cooking Time: Less than 15 minutes
Number of Servings: 8
